It’s 1986, and Gene Baur is selling vegan hotdogs at Grateful Dead shows. Surrounded by the sounds of Jerry Garcia and company, Baur spends his time educating fellow “Deadheads” about the cruelties of animal agriculture, providing firsthand accounts from his investigations at factory farms, stockyards and slaughterhouses.
